Spain international Claudia Pena has officially signed a new contract with Harlequins, solidifying her future with the club after an impressive debut season. The 20-year-old winger scored eight tries in just 13 appearances, making her one of the standout players in the Premiership Women's Rugby league.

Pena follows in the footsteps of her international compatriot Laura Delgado and teammate Beth Wilcock, who have also recently committed to Harlequins. This trio of signings underscores the club's ambition to build a formidable squad for the upcoming seasons.

Despite Harlequins' semi-final defeat to Saracens in the Premiership Women's Rugby playoffs, Pena's performance has been a silver lining for the team. Reflecting on her first year, Pena shared her excitement and gratitude:

"This first year has been an incredible experience of growth, both personally and in rugby, thanks to the people around me at the club. Every moment shared has taught me something valuable, and that's why I want to repeat this experience next year, continue learning from my teammates, and give my best to the team."
